2025 Race Program Update
We started working on our 2025 race program in October and have made great strides getting the work done by our team. We do all the work ourselves, with the exception of the engine that had to be sent to R&D Performance for a constant oil leak. The root cause was a cracked timing cover. It has been replaced, including new valve springs, pilot bushing, spark plugs and exhaust gaskets. We are currently working on the body getting it installed. The roof, front and rear bumper covers and trunk were all painted and ready to install.
